Chapter 1: The Fire that Changed Everything.
All he could remember was waking up and smelling smoke. He could hear screams. He could hear sirens. He remembered waking up and going out in the hallway, only to see fire and hear more screams. He remembered getting outside, somehow. Then, he remembered seeing the house burn to the ground. The firemen showing up, too late. They were gone. His family, his friends. Gone. He was the only survivor. He had to get away, had to go someplace, somewhere. He had to get away from it all. There had to be someplace he could go. He started running... and running. He didn't care where he ended up. The tears in his eyes blurred his vision. He didn't care, as long as he got away. He couldn't look back. He finally stopped and looked around. He was in downtown Tokyo. He kept running. He bumped into someone.
"Whoa! Slowdown kid. Where's the fire?" the guy asked. That made him more mad and sad at the same time. He couldn't control it any longer. He started crying. He didn't even know this guy, but he told him his whole story. He couldn't believe how much he was crying. He had never realized how much they meant to him, his friends, his family, the people closest to him, the people who cared about him, and loved him. He looked at the guy he had bumped into.
